Nagelkirk, Robert 10/22/1929 – 11/26/2022 Born October 22, 1929, Robert John Nagelkirk was the son of Peter William Nagelkirk and Jerina Pentinga Nagelkirk. “Bob” was called home to be with the Lord on November 26th, 2022. Funeral services were held on Tuesday, November 29, at Matthysse Kuiper DeGraaf Funeral Home, Kentwood. Robert is survived by his wife, Helen; four children, Beverly, John, Roy, and Russell; and sisters Marge, Wilma, and Marilyn. Our memories of Dad include: He loved wearing his SeaBees hat from his reserve service during the Korean War with the Seabees (a construction division of the Navy); doing any type of car or home repair; was always cheerful and hopeful; very practically minded; savvy with money; could talk anyone else through a car or home repair; was a great encouragement to his grandchildren in discussions of their future plans; was never afraid to learn new digital technology, and never lost his sense of humor.
